Publisher's Summary

Clean and wholesome American mail order bride historical western short story romance by best-selling Western author Katie Wyatt.

Hoffnung, Wyoming - December, 1865

For Hanna, married life hasn’t been what she hoped for at all. She and her husband live with his mother and five rowdy younger siblings. Otto isn’t romantic or even seems to take much notice of her. Hanna is feels invisible and miserable.

Will she ever find her place in this big, busy family?

Should they take Eugene Munro’s threats seriously?

Will the accidents around the farm force the family to abandon the land they love?

Roll up your sleeves and join Hanna as she and her new family fight against the man who’s determined to put an end to the town called Hope.
